Vasilis Barkas: 5.5

The goalkeeper had his first real test. He made some questionable decisions that could have led to additional goals. He didn’t play the ball well off out of his feet on occasions and the second goal against Ferencvaros seemed to have been misplayed. Seemingly stuck to his line, Barkas seemed out of his element against stronger competition.

Christopher Jullien: 6

One of the biggest complaints against Jullien is that he isn’t physical enough. That was on full display Wednesday evening. He wasn’t terrible, but the opposing offence was able to capitalise.

Greg Taylor: 6.5

Faring slightly better, Taylor was largely a non-factor in the match. He did little on either side of the pitch to influence the match. Celtic is used to having an impact player in that position and the last two seasons now that has not been the case. The Hoops will need a more dynamic play-maker in the position to help them advance into Europe.

Scott Brown: 7

The last few matches have had supporters raising their eyebrows at Brown’s fitness. He looked better on Wednesday and helped control the pace of the match. The midfield early on was having trouble making even simple passes. Brown helped them settle in with a good pace and gave the squad a fighting stretch down the line. There are still a lot of questions regarding him heading into a long season though.
